XPeng Announces Inclusion of Its Shares in the Shenzhen-Hong Kong Stock Connect Program
February 8, 2022 9:51 PM ESTGUANGZHOU, China--(BUSINESS WIRE)-- XPeng Inc. (XPeng or the Company, NYSE: XPEV, HKEX: 9868), a leading Chinese smart electric vehicle (Smart EV) company, today announced that the Companys Ordinary Shares, which trade on The Stock Exchange of Hong Kong Limited (HKEX), are included in the Shenzhen-Hong Kong Stock Connect programs, effective on February 09, 2022, according to the announcement issued by the Shenzhen Stock Exchange....
